The brief

The services will be commissioned across three themed lots, with a strong emphasis on collaboration and integration.

All appointed providers must work in partnership to ensure a cohesive, coordinated, and seamless experience for both residents and referring professionals.

This includes maintaining robust communication across all lots.

The three lots are: •Lot 1: Supported Hospital Discharge •Lot 2: Community-led Mental Health Outreach •Lot 3: Community-led Wellbeing and Independence Given the breadth of expertise required, we welcome proposals from partnerships, consortia, or lead provider/subcontractor arrangements.

The Council values the unique identity and recognition of individual organisations and encourages solutions that preserve choice for service users.

Contract Value and Term The total maximum annual budget is £750,000, allocated as follows: •Lot 1: £200,000 •Lot 2: £150,000 •Lot 3: £400,000 Providers may bid for all three lots but will be awarded a maximum of two.

Providers should indicate, in the event of scoring highest in all three lots, which two lots they would have a preference to deliver.

The contract(s) will run for an initial term of five years, with the option to extend for a further two years, subject to performance and budget availability.

Providers will be expected to manage fluctuations in demand within the agreed contract value.
